Job Description Summary

A Senior Medical Science Liaison (Sr. MSL) Ophthalmology will establish and maintain relationships with key stakeholders in the medical / scientific community within their geographic and therapeutic area.

This field-based role requires a strong scientific background to provide credible clinical / scientific data and education to clinicians, key opinion leaders (KOLs), professional societies, and payers.

The Sr. MSL will demonstrate advanced medical and scientific expertise, support medical strategies, enhance thought leader relationships, and contribute to projects that increase the value and productivity of the MSL team and Medical Affairs.

Organizational Relationship / Scope :

This position reports to the Field Director of MSLs. The MSL may have contact with internal colleagues in marketing, sales, research and development, strategy / portfolio management, regulatory, and medical affairs.

External collaboration includes trade associations, professional societies, payers, clinicians, policy thought leaders, and various government personnel and agencies.

Collaboration across a matrix organization is required. MSLs have no sales objectives or accountability for prescribing or sales of any MNK product(s) and are required to avoid any situations that could create the appearance that they have such responsibilities.
